 The ''prime'' keyword in the first command causes the network to run with external Poisson input and save its network state at the end of the run to a set of files created under ''/tmp''. Note that you can give any other directory name where you want the files to be created. The second call to the progrem without the ''--prime'' argument causes the program to read the current network state from these saved files and runs the network for the specified period in ''simtime''. All spiking output and the memory trace ([[mem]] file) of a single neuron are written to the directory specified with ''--dir'' and are prefixed with ''coba.*''. The ''prime'' keyword in the first command causes the network to run with external Poisson input and save its network state at the end of the run to a set of files created under ''/tmp''. -If the ''prime'' directive is set (via the command line) this code will create a [[PoissonGroup]] and connect it to the excitatory and inhibitory populations. If ''prime==false'' this will try to load the network state from the hopefully existing save files stored under ''/tmp/save*'' in our example.
